Reporting and Data Submission Requirements. County shall comply with all data and information submission requirements specified in this Agreement. A. County shall provide all applicable data and information required by federal and/or State law in order to receive any funds to pay for its MHSA programs, PATH grant (if the County receives funds from this grant), MHBG grant (if the County receives funds from this grant), CCP program, or County provision of community mental health services provided with 1991 realignment funds (other than Medi-Cal). These federal and State laws include Title 42 of the United States Code, sections 290cc-21 through 290cc-35 and 300x through 300x-9, inclusive, Welfare & Institutions Code sections 5610 and 5664 and the regulations that implement, interpret or make specific, these federal and State laws and any DHCS-issued guidelines that relate to the programs or services. B. County shall comply with DHCS reporting requirements related to the County’s receipt of federal or State funding for mental health programs. County shall submit complete and accurate information to DHCS, and as applicable the Mental Health Services Oversight and Accountability Commission, including, but not limited, to the following: 1) Client and Service Information (CSI) System Data, as specified in Title 9 of the California Code of Regulations, section 3530.10.
